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ks for your employees. Here are some common warning signs that show you need commercial water damage restoration: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your office building, it’s a sign that mold and mildew are growing in the affected area. Our team will identify the source of the odor and take steps to remove it.

Water Stains and Warping

Visible water stains and warping on your walls, floors, and ceilings are a clear indication that water damage has occurred. Our team will assess the damage and develop a plan to repair and restore your property.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Peeling paint and wallpaper are often a sign of water damage, as the moisture has caused the paint or adhesive to break down. Our team will replace the affected materials and restore your property to its original condition.

Cracked Drywall and Ceiling Tiles

Cracked drywall and ceiling tiles are a clear indication that water damage has occurred. Our team will assess the damage and develop a plan to repair and restore your property.

Commercial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ak under a sink Yes No You can fix this small leak yourself with a few basic tools.
Burst pipe in a confined space No Yes Confined spaces can be hazardous, and a burst pipe needs specialized equipment to contain the damage.
Water damage to a large area (e.g., entire floor) No Yes A large area of water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to contain and dry the area.
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air.
Water damage to electrical systems No Yes Water damage to electrical systems is a serious safety hazard and needs professional expertise to repair.

Commercial Water Damage Restoration Cost in Mercer Island, WA

The cost of commercial water damage restoration in Mercer Island,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ved, including any necessary repairs and restoration work.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Sanitizing and C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, and local conditions.
Repair and Restoration Work $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of materials damaged.
Moisture Detection and Testing $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of materials damaged.
